A polite request is a way of asking for something in a courteous manner. Examples include: 'Could you please send me the report by Friday?', 'Would you mind taking a look at this proposal?', and 'Could I ask you to review this document?' Politeness is achieved by using terms like 'please' and 'thank you,' as well as showing respect for the person's time and effort.

- What makes a request polite? A request is polite when it uses courteous language such as 'please' and 'thank you' and acknowledges the other person's situation.
- Can you give more examples of polite requests? Sure! Examples include 'Would you be able to help me with this?' and 'Could I have a moment of your time to discuss something?'
- Why is politeness important in communication? Politeness fosters respect, improves relationships, and increases the likelihood of receiving a positive response.
- How can I improve my politeness in conversation? You can improve by practicing courteous phrases, being respectful, and actively listening to others.
